IZICELO
Kusetshenziswa kabanzi kwisekethe ye-DC-Link ukuhlunga isitoreji samandla
Ingathatha indawo yama-capacitor e-electrolytic, ukusebenza okungcono kanye nokuphila isikhathi eside
I-inverter ye-PV, i-wind power converter; izinhlobo ze-aAl ze-frequency converter kanye ne-inverter power supply; Imoto kagesi ne-hybrid emsulwa; Amadivayisi e-SVG, ama-SVC kanye nezinye izinhlobo zokuphathwa kwekhwalithi yamandla.
